It has been announced that the forest fire that has been ongoing for 12 days in northeastern Japan has been brought under control.

It was reported that the forest fire, which began on February 26 in northeastern Japan and damaged at least 210 buildings, has been brought under control. Authorities stated that there is no longer a risk of the fire, which has been burning for 12 days, spreading further.

Stating that the forest fire has been brought under control, officials announced that efforts to completely extinguish the flames are continuing.
